According to the The Wall Street Journal, WWE’s board is investigating a $3 million “hush-money settlement”, that Vince McMahon paid to a former female WWE employee over an alleged affair between them.
This ex-female employee was hired by WWE in 2019 as a paralegal. The January 2022 separation agreement doesn’t allow this ex-employee to discuss her relationship with Vince or disparage him (tap here to read more).
According to Fightful Select, WWE sent the following email to their employees, wrestlers & other staff members regarding this investigation:
“The Wall Street Journal has published a report about WWE with allegations that we and our Board of Directors take seriously.
We are cooperating fully with the independent investigation initiated by our Board of Directors.”

On this day in Pro Wrestling history on June 16, 1992, Ted Turner’s World Championship Wrestling aired ‘WCW Clash Of The Champions XIX: NWA World Tag Team Title Tournament’ LIVE on TBS from the McAlister Field House of The Citadel in Charleston, South Carolina.
This was the 19th out of a total of 35 Clash of the Champions events, that aired between 1988 and 1997.
